Velostra's dispatcher assigns drivers by scoring proximity, acceptance history, and shift fatigue. Scores are recomputed every tick; ties break on driver idle time. Don't touch the fatigue penalty without sign-off from the routing lead — it interacts with the Harwick depot's overnight rules. All weights live in `assignment_weights.py` and are loaded once at startup, so changes need a redeploy. The current production weights are listed below.

tuning constants:
RATE_LIMITS = {
    "goriel": 284,
    "brieth": 236,
    "lamvan": 916,
    "druok": 255,
    "wenion": 979,
    "istmir": 343,
    "queniel": 302,
}

Subject: Reconciliation cut-over complete

Hi —

Welcome aboard. The nightly inventory reconciliation job moved from the old Tallyhouse batch runner to the new Quillstock pipeline last night. Old job is disabled, not deleted; don't re-enable it. Discrepancy reports now land in the shared drive under /recon, same format. First run finished clean with 14 minor variances, all auto-resolved. If counts look off, check the pipeline before escalating. Current production settings for the job are listed below.

settings of tagef-bawif:
DRUIX_HOST=druix.zemvarlabs.internal
DRUIX_PORT=8000

## Read-Replica Lag Alarm

New folks: the ReplicaLagHigh alarm covers the Ostrel reporting replicas. It fires when lag exceeds 90 seconds for five minutes. Most triggers come from the nightly Bramwell export job, which is expected and auto-resolves. Do not fail over the replica yourself — that requires the data-platform lead's approval and a change ticket. If the alarm persists past 20 minutes with no export running, write to the platform inbox.

billing contact of yahip-yadup = eliax.druix@zemvarworks.corp

The garage occupancy feed for the Brindlewood campus arrives over a message queue every thirty seconds, one record per level, published by the Stallgrid edge boxes. Counts can briefly go negative when a sensor double-fires on exit; the ingest job clamps these to zero and flags the interval. If the feed stalls for more than five minutes, the dashboard falls back to the last known snapshot. Sensor mappings, queue names, and the replay procedure are documented on the internal page below.

runbook for tahog-kadug: https://gitlab.qirvanworks.corp/projects/pages/view/b139298aed28